All children younger than 2 years should be vaccinated with PCV13. The primary series consists of three doses routinely given at 2, 4, and 6 months of age. The first dose can be given as early as 6 weeks of age. A fourth (booster) dose should be given between 12 and 15 months. For children vaccinated when they are younger than 12 months, the minimum interval between doses is 4 weeks. Separate doses given to children at 12 months of age and older by at least 8 weeks.
